Output 5d580937cbfb99dffbfa2cd14cfd74489a35b7617c3887fecd5f3446e44d704b:0

value
58444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9534c880fc6fd5fff6a1a8be2620f7a1fb0d72 OP_EQUAL
address
3EKmv3VaExQjx11asmTVptxfpskMgn4sjQ
transaction
5d580937cbfb99dffbfa2cd14cfd74489a35b7617c3887fecd5f3446e44d704b
confirmations
158341
spent
true